Summary of the Controversial Tweet Regarding Kamal Adwan Hospital

In a poignant social media post shared by Jackson Hinkle, a prominent political commentator, the focus is drawn to the distressing situation faced by healthcare professionals at Kamal Adwan Hospital, a facility located in Gaza, Palestine. The tweet, which includes a heart-wrenching image of doctors and nurses, serves as a powerful reminder of the human cost of conflict in the region. Hinkle’s message highlights the ongoing struggles of medical staff amid the violence that has erupted in Gaza and critiques the perceived hypocrisy of Israeli reactions to damage caused to their own facilities.

Background Context: The Humanitarian Crisis in Gaza

The ongoing conflict between Israel and Palestine has led to a severe humanitarian crisis, particularly in Gaza, where medical facilities have been overwhelmed with casualties. Hospitals like Kamal Adwan are often the frontline responders to the violence, providing critical medical care to the injured. The emotional and physical toll on healthcare workers is immense, as they navigate the challenges of treating patients in a war zone while facing the constant threat of violence.
